Child Sponsorship FAQs

Most frequent questions and answers

Child Sponsorship ensures that your sponsored child is able to attend school, remain within their family’s care, receive healthy meals to fuel their studies, and save for their future education. Our sponsorship ideal also means a portion of your monthly support will allow Bring up a child ministry Uganda( BCMU) to implement life changing programs for children in need in Uganda.

Yes! You can sponsor as many children as you like!

The minimum amount to sponsor a child is $39 a month. Monthly sponsorship opportunities are also available at $50, $60 and $80 per month. You are also welcome to fully sponsor a child’s education. Please reach out to us if you’d like to learn more.

We understand the realities of individual financial situations. If you need to discontinue your child sponsorship, we will work to identify another person to take your place in supporting your sponsored child.  We also invite you to participate in that process by advocating with family, friends, and co-workers to help to identify a new sponsor for the child you support!

Our prayer is that many children BCMU supports through sponsorship will rise out of poverty and no longer need the assistance of a sponsorship program. Should this happen, we will notify you about the change in your child’s circumstances and will happily reassign your sponsorship to another child in need of sponsorship support. Your ongoing support can have a lifelong impact on the lives of many vulnerable children in Uganda.

In addition to the knowledge that you are truly intervening for the one and the many, sponsors receive:

  • The ability to correspond with your sponsored child.
  • A special update and photos, videos of your sponsored child twice or more every year.
  • A special video greeting from your sponsored child each year.
  • The option to send a Christmas gift and greeting to your sponsored child.
  • Receive a receipt for tax deductions on any monthly donations
  • The joy of knowing you are changing a child’s life forever!

For every sponsorship dollar you contribute, 85 per cents goes directly to BCMU’s sponsorship program! The remaining 15 per cents goes toward administrative costs.

Depending on your sponsorship level, 6, 18, or 30 additional children receive life-changing support opportunities annually thanks to your sponsorship contribution! These allow us to break the cycle of poverty for these children by uplifting home cares, intervening for at-risk children so they never enter an institution, and helping young people living in institutions to attend college so they can grow into independent, successful adults. Through your sponsorship, you’re intervening for these additional kids in addition to continuing to change the life of your current sponsored child.

About Bring Up a Child

BRING UP A CHILD MINISTRY UGANDA (BCMU) is a non-profit Christian organization based in Bugiri District in the Eastern Uganda. The ministry exists to serve the homeless, distressed and HIV/AIDS orphans and families marginalized with poverty. The unique challenges of these children/people are addressed through programs that promote: Spiritual welfare, Education, Health care, Poverty eradication and Social-economical sustainability
